Which statement best describes the fact that gases can be compressed?
The particles in a gas do not have a fixed volume.
The particles in a gas are very far apart.
The particles in a gas have no force of attraction (bonds) between them.
The particles in a gas are constantly moving very rapidly.

Which statement(s) best describes the fact that a liquid flows?
The particles in a liquid have weak bonds between them.
The particles in a liquid have no fixed position.
The particles in a liquid are close and touching.
The particles in a liquid are moving slowly over each other.

When a liquid evaporates the temperature of the liquid decreases. Which statement(s) best describes why this happens?
Some closely packed particles at the surface of the liquid break the bonds which are keeping them close to neighbouring particles.
Breaking bonds is an endothermic process (requires energy).
When particles enter the gaseous state they take their (kinetic) energy with them.
Particles at the surface of the liquid make bonds with gaseous particles above the surface of the liquid.
Making bonds is an exothermic process (releases energy).

The boiling points of four different liquids are given below. The particles in the liquids have approximately the same mass. Which liquid has the weakest bonds between its particles?
Liquid A boils at 20°C
Liquid B boils at 30°C
Liquid C boils at 40°C
Liquid D boils at 50°C
